Alan Pardew is a former English football manager and player, best known for his time managing clubs such as Newcastle United and Crystal Palace. He led Crystal Palace to the FA Cup final in 2016, where they faced Manchester United, but experienced a memorable moment of embarrassment known as his 'dance of shame' after a touchline incident. Pardew's coaching style and tactical approaches have garnered both praise and criticism throughout his career, making him a notable figure in English football.
